The Climate Crisis and the Urgency for Action

  • 🌡️ Science indicates that a 1.5°C temperature overshoot by the end of the century is now inevitable, but immediate action is crucial to keep it as small and short as possible.
  • ⚠️ Every fraction of a degree matters, and any delay in addressing climate change is indefensible.

Protecting Forests

  • 🌳 Forests, vital for climate stability and biodiversity, are being destroyed and degraded, which must end now.
  • 🌲 We must halt deforestation by 2030, protect intact tropical and boreal forests, conserve peatlands, end illegal logging, and eliminate deforestation from supply chains.
  • 🌱 Restoring degraded land with nature-based solutions can protect watersheds, reduce disaster risk, and create green jobs.

Safeguarding Oceans

  • 🌊 Oceans absorb a quarter of human CO2 emissions and most excess heat, but they are warming, acidifying, and rising, threatening lives and economies.
  • 🐠 We must enhance coastal protection, restore coral reefs, seagrass, and mangroves, tackle pollution, and expand effectively managed marine protected areas.
  • 🤝 Delivering on the 30x30 goal to protect 30% of land and ocean by 2030 is essential.

Honoring Indigenous Peoples and Legal Responsibilities

  • ⚖️ The International Court of Justice has highlighted that nations are obligated to cooperate on climate change issues, including sea level rise.
  • 🧑‍🤝‍🧑 Indigenous peoples, who have safeguarded lands and waters for millennia, receive insufficient climate finance and recognition; their rights and participation must be upheld.
  • 💰 Protecting forests and oceans is not charity but a legal, moral, and economic responsibility.
